Web20 aug. 2024 · Glass is an inert material that does not corrode. By lining the inside of the water heater with glass, the steel is protected from corrosion. This prolongs the life of the water heater and prevents rusting and leaks. In addition, glass is a good insulator. This helps to keep the water inside the heater hot for longer periods of time. CEE recommends replacing your water heater with one that (1) is efficient, and (2) has sealed combustion venting. When you need a new water heater, ask your contractor to install a power-vented (sealed combustion) water heater with a UEF rating of at least 0.64.
